Le Mans winning Audi R8 used Kistler ROADYN
System 2000 in suspension development.
With five podiums out of seven starts in the Le Mans
24 Hour race, the exceptionally reliable and fast Audi
R8 is the most consistently successful sports car in
the world.
Making a small but essential contribution to the success of the R8, the
enhanced Kistler (www.kistler.com) six component RoaDyn System
2000 measuring wheel is used during development to analyse
suspension performance under normal track testing. In addition to
high performance racing cars, the RoaDyn System 2000 is widely
used on less exotic vehicles from the smallest cars to the largest trucks.
The latest version of the RoaDyn system uses nearfield telemetry
and on-wheel signal conditioning to minimise and simplify installation.
Automatic sensor detection and calibration data upload enhances
operational safety and reduces the number of cable connections.
The highly modular design includes a single control system for all
measuring wheel applications to keep costs as low as possible as
the RoaDyn System 2000 measuring wheel can be used in applications
ranging from the smallest cars, SUV's and vans to light goods vehicles
and heavy trucks.
